MORNING

The first thing I do in the morning is going to the kitchen to leave my kettle heating up so I can have my matutinal tea, then I go to the bathroom and that's when this routine starts.
First I wash my face with a gel wash. I use Garnier's Pure Active Fruit Energy Daily Energising Gel Wash. It has extracts of grapefruit and pomegranate which are commonly included in products for oily skin.
After my skin is completly dry I use a micellar water. This type of product usualy serves as a cleanser but I tend to use it as a toner. It's not the strongest toner but since I have fairly sensitive skin it works for me. I use Garnier's Micellar Cleansing Water.
This last step depends if I'm going to wear foundation or BB Cream that day. I don't like moisturizers. During the Summer I only use them at night before bed because they're an important part of your skin care no matter what's your skin type.  But, in the Winter, the story changes and I use it if I'm not going to wear anything else on my face. My all time favorite moisturizer is Garnier's Hydra Adapt for Combination to Oily skins. It has a sorbet like texture and feels uncannily fresh.

NIGHT

My nightime routine changes if I've worn any makeup during the day.
If I have, my first step is to clean my face combining makeup wipes and micellar water. These two products get the job done but sometimes, if I've worn something very, very longlasting I use a makeup remover with a cream consistency.
After that I use a exfoliating cream. Garnier's Pure Active 3 in 1 Wash, Scrub & Mask is a product that me and Anna use. I also use Garnier's Pure Active Fruit Energy Daily Energising Gel Scrub, it's softer and gentler that the 3 in 1 and my sensitive skin sometimes deserves a little bit of that gentleness.
Then I finish the day with, once more my micellar water and my moisturizer.

FULL BODY

As I've mentioned in my last video, I love bathtime. Yet, it's important to take care of all your skin, principally if you wash yourself in really hot water like I do. After showering or bathing I use sweet almond oil all over my body while I'm not fully dry. This kind of oil is commonly used during pregnancy to avoid stretch marks and it's, in fact, what my mother used when pregnant and during her whole life. I use it to keep my skin smooth and deeply moisturized. As I said before, it helps with strech marks, which I have in a generous amount, but it only prevents you from getting more, the oil won't fade the ones you already have.
